(3G安卓课程大纲.docxVIP

  1. 1、本文档共12页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
(3G安卓课程大纲

第一阶段:Android平台构建企业岗位定位——Android System Development Engineer(Android系统移植工程师)课程设计说明——作为一个真正意义上的开放性移动设备综合平台,Android包括了操作系统、用户界面和应用程序等移动设备开发所需的全部软件,这就意味着学习 Android 的意义不仅仅是应用程序的开发那么简单。我们需要通过对其框架,结构的分析,掌握通用Android平台的构建方式,从而实现将 Android 应用到任何移动硬件平台上,支持各种硬件设备、应用于多种行业的研发目标。课程目标——全面深入的掌握Android系统环境搭建、移植及底层开发技术。?华清远见是国内唯一系统讲解Android平台构建,并配合最新硬件平台和开源平板电脑实战训练的专业培训机构。课程安排——序号课程名称课程内容掌握要求13G移动开发应用平台(Android/iPhone/Symbian/WindowsMobile)分析介绍介绍目前最主流的几款3G移动开发平台:Android、IPhone、symiban、Windows Mobile等开发平台的发展现状和趋势,另外本阶段课程会针对开发人员,重点介绍这几款开发平台开发的特点以及差异性。熟悉2Android 底层架构分析介绍Google Android 软件架构,介绍Android源代码目录结构及主要源码,并重点介绍将Android系统移植到新硬件平台的相关技术及常见问题的解决方式。精通3Android平台移植介绍Android系统移植的具体操作步骤与方法,如:1、配置Linux内核使其支持Android2、在Linux内核中添加Android触摸屏驱动3、键盘驱动等4、Android多点触摸的功能5、制作yaffs2和jffs2格式的Android文件系统精通4项目实践--Anroid系统移植通过项目实践,一步一步把Android系统移植到Cortex-A系列的开发板及开源平板电脑中,并搭建Android运行环境,为后续的开发提供必要的软硬件基础。熟练????????????华清远见自主研发最新的Cortex-A实验平台华清远见自主研发智能家居综合实验箱华清远见自主研发开源平板电脑第二阶段:Android编程语言基础和企业级Android开发服务器端编程企业岗位定位——Android Development Engineer(Android开发工程师)课程设计说明——力求让学员在最短的时间内熟悉几款主流的移动开发平台,并帮助学员从接触3G移动开发平台及Java语言的第一天起就形成正确思考问题的方式。培训过程中,我们更多的是向学员展示企业中真正要重视的问题。同时,注重让学员养成良好的编码和文档注释习惯,编写出企业认可的代码。编程语言是任何一个应用程序开发者的必备技能。扎实的编程基础不仅能使后期的学习得心应手,也可以在企业的中畅通无阻。在本阶段的课程中,主要以Java语言为教学工具,对Android应用程序编程语言进行强化。同时,让学员在进行Android手机应用开发的时候,能对Android服务器端开发有较深入了解。课程目标——练就扎实的基本功,强化编程基础,养成良好的代码编写习惯。?华清远见关注的是学员在移动开发行业中的长远发展,帮助学员编写出企业真正需要和认可的编码,是我们义不容辞的责任。课程安排——序号课程名称课程内容掌握要求1Android系统语言编程基础本阶段内容主要以Java语言编程核心为主,帮助具备一定C语言基础的学员实现平滑过渡。具体内容包括:1、Java开发工具的安装和配置2、Java虚拟机原理3、Java的数据类型4、运算符和表达式5、流程控制6、数组精通2Android系统环境下的面向对象编程本阶段内容是在上一阶段基础上,针对Java面向对象的程序设计思想进行提高和强化,具体内容包括:1、字符串2、抽象类3、接口4、内部类5、类的继承6、多态7、代码调试8、捕获异常处理精通3Android系统环境下的数据结构和算法编程的实质就是使用不同的算法去操作不同的数据结构,在本部分课程中将基于之前课程中所学习的简单数据描述和数据操作的知识,系统的讲解常见数据结构,具体内容包括:1、集合2、队列3、树4、图5、常用排序算法6、常用查找算法精通4Android系统环境下的数据库设计和开发本阶段课程主要是让学员对MySQL数据库有较深入的了解,熟悉关系型数据库中的核心技术,具体内容包括:1、表2、事务3、SQL语句4、使用JDBC操作数据库熟悉5企业级Android开发服务器端编程本阶段课程主要是让学员能熟悉Web应用的基本架构,熟悉Java Web开发的基本方法,能编写Web应用并为后续的Android应用开发服务。熟悉6项目实践--企业级Androi

文档评论(0)

saity3 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档